GEP Happiness Score

The employee happiness at GEP is listed in the Bottom 35% of similar size companies on Comparably. Compensation is an important aspect of employee happiness and at GEP, 42% of employees feel they are paid fairly, 59% are satisfied with their benefits, and 25% are satisfied with their stock/equity. 74% of GEP employees feel their work environment is positive meaning GEP is a happy place to work.

GEP Happiness At a Glance

GEP employees rate their happiness at the workplace a "C-" (based on 172 ratings). The Happiness score describes employees well-being based on various topics such as positivity in the workplace, opportunities for professional growth, and satisfaction towards compensation and benefits.

45 GEP employees answered questions like "What percent of your potential do you think you are using?" and "Is your work environment positive or negative?" In general, employees in the Engineering department are considered to be the most happy at GEP. Also, employees with 1 to 3 Years Experience are more satisfied at GEP, while employees with Over 10 Years Experience are the least satisfied.

GEP's Happiness score ranks in 2nd place when compared to competitors Zycus, Power Advocate, and POOL4TOOL. The company is also in the Bottom 30% of other companies in New York and Bottom 35% of other companies on Comparably.
